For Fall 2026, we are seeking instructors for ECE271, a practicum course taught in Spanish. Responsibilities include teaching the practicum curriculum in person at 45 Franklin Street in Lawrence one evening every other week, as well as conducting daytime practicum site visits and evaluations at students' practicum placement locations throughout the semester. We are additionally seeking instructors to join our Adjunct Faculty pool to teach a variety of Early Childhood Education courses on an as-needed basis. Classes are typically offered at NECC's Haverhill and/or Lawrence campuses during daytime and evening hours, as well as online, face-to-face, and in hybrid formats. Positions will be available pending sufficient enrollment.
